Sustainability Certifications

Developers should pursue sustainability certifications to address growing regulatory requirements, meet corporate 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) goals, and build skills for creating energy-efficient applications that minimize carbon emissions

Pros

  • +They are particularly valuable in cloud computing, data center management, and green software development roles, where optimizing resource usage directly impacts operational costs and environmental sustainability
